I recently rebuilt the engine on my 425 John Deere and I tried to get the wiring back the way it was but must have done something wrong because now when I turn the key to "on" the starter turns. Somehow I also seemed to by-pass the brake pedal safety switch also. There appears to be only one way the wiring plugs can be plugged in. Anybody got an answer or a wiring diagram?

I found the answer and thought I'd post it in case anybody else has this problem. The problem was a stuck starter relay, k1 , which is on the circuit board under the dashboard on the right side of the tractor. I pecked on it and it unstuck and the tractor starts normally now, but I'll probably have to buy a new relay in the future.
